
Preparing dough manually can become physically demanding when a kitchen produces chapatis, breads, puris, pizzas or bakery products throughout the day. The challenge is not simply mixing flour and water. Commercial kitchens need repeatable dough texture across multiple batches.

What Happens During Mechanical Kneading
Kneading develops the dough structure by repeatedly working the ingredients together. With manual preparation, the final result can change depending on the person kneading, batch size and time spent working the dough.
Mechanical kneading provides a controlled process. Once operators establish the appropriate ingredient quantity and mixing duration, it becomes easier to reproduce similar batches.
This can help kitchens achieve:
- More consistent dough texture
- Faster preparation of larger batches
- Reduced manual effort
- Better workflow during busy hours
- More predictable production planning
Capacity Should Match Actual Production
Buying an oversized machine does not automatically improve kitchen efficiency. Businesses should calculate how much dough they prepare per batch and how many batches are required during a normal working day.
A restaurant producing chapati dough may need a different configuration from a bakery preparing bread or a catering operation processing large quantities for functions.
For commercial kitchens in Nagpur and across Maharashtra, production can also fluctuate considerably between normal working days and events or seasonal demand. Buyers should therefore consider both routine output and realistic peak requirements.
Dough Quality Still Depends on the Recipe
A Dough Kneading Machine improves process consistency, but it cannot compensate for an unsuitable recipe. Flour quality, water ratio, ingredient temperature and resting time continue to influence the finished dough.
Operators should standardise recipes and measure ingredients instead of relying entirely on visual estimates.
This combination of standardised ingredients and controlled kneading can make production more repeatable.
Plan the Workflow Around the Machine
The machine should be positioned where flour and other ingredients can be loaded conveniently and finished dough can be removed without interrupting other preparation work.
Cleaning access also matters because flour and dough residue can remain around bowls, mixing components and nearby surfaces.
